New engine low oil pressure
 
So having spent way more on this car than I intended to everything is installed
The engine is a built motor with slightly looser tolerances. It is running one of the ported oil pumps with billet gears from Boundary engineering(standard pressure relief spring-not shimmed).
The engine has had oil pressure since start up but it has always read pretty low. The oil pressure on start up on the oil pressure gauge(aftermarket gauge with sender in the stock location in the head) read about 30 and then would drop to about 20psi(as the oil warms) at anything over 2K rpm. it has about 8-10psi at idle. So we hooked up a mechanical gauge from the block and the engine only gets up to 40psi even up to 6K rpm. I haven't revved it any higher than that.
So, I know from searching that miata motors run lower oil pressure than the subarus I am used to and flow is more important than pressure. However, this still seems a little low and I was going to rev the motor to 8K or so.
I am not particularly experienced with miatas and so does anyone think this is safe? Should we go ahead and tune the engine?
If it seems too low what is the source-partially stuck open pressure relief valve? Bad oil pump seems unlikely, I don't think the engine is loose enough to account for this low a reading.
Any thoughts you might have, I would rather not pull the engine but it feels like it is going to be necessary.

My '95 idled at 10-13 psi when warm, before and after my build. My NB idles around 9-10 psi, engine internals are stock. Rotella T used in both cars. My '95 would gain 10 psi for every 1,000 RPM but I can't remember where it maxed out. My NB does the same thing and seems to max out at 45 psi. All readings taken from a sandwich plate at the oil filter and with AutoMeter gauges.

Faeflora 01-05-2011 10:44 AM

When hot: mine idles at 8-15psi. Maxes out around 45/50psi. I have a VVT head. Stock sensor location. Miata roadster billet opg.

Machismo 01-05-2011 10:46 AM

I'm with RotorNut... after installing the Advanced Autosports oil pressure sender kit and grounding the gauge properly for the DB gauges I'm around 10 to 15 psi when warm at idle. It is a real time sweep gauge and pegs up to 40-45 psi at singing speed. Thought it read low but have come to find it is normal. I went this route for the '96 as I wanted real time working pressures and not the good ole dummy gauge.

TravisR 01-05-2011 11:49 AM

That's about right, it depends alot on the viscosity, but the relief valve will be fairly open at about 45-50. You probably won't see over 60 without shims in the pump though.

The only failure mode that you can possibly have is debris in your oil pump relief valve, but it definitely doesn't sound like you have that.

One last question. Should there be a further increase in oil pressure as the revs go from 6-8K?

TravisR 01-05-2011 02:21 PM

Probably not, once you hit the "max" the relief valve should control the pressure pretty well. You might get a little more, but it won't be another 30% or anything.

JasonC SBB 01-05-2011 03:10 PM

pressure relief valve doesn't have a lot of "gain" - the range of regulated pressure may be 20-30 psi.
